Rated 3 out of 5 stars

Tried PureRaw 6 as DxO claimed dramatic…

Tried PureRaw 6 as DxO claimed dramatic reduction in file-bloat in output. Stopped using it when I found that an 86.6MB file from the 40megapixel Fuji X-E5 was swollen to 141.4MB by running it through PR6. I understand that this is caused by PR6 creating a linear .dng file, and I don’t know why DxO insists on doing that, with the consequential file-bloating. Maybe I’ll try it again if/when I can afford a 10TB SSD to store my picture files on. PR6 is definitely a good piece of software, marginally beating Lightroom as a pre-development work space, but this comes at considerable cost in disk space.
*******
Following response to my criticism above by representatives of DxO, I have revisited PR6 to re-assess it in the light of their comments. What I found was that I had overlooked the “Output Settings” icon on the right hand side of the PR6 window, where you can access DNG Output Format options, which is where the High Fidelity Compression option is lurking.
Τhis changes everything: with High Fidelity Compression selected PR6 worked its wonders on my raw file, and in one case shrank a 43.1MB Fuji .RAF file to a just 8.7MB .dng output file. Quite incredible, but true. And from what I’ve read on the web this is the result of DxO’s having adopted new compression technologies like JPEG XL and DNG 1.7. All beyond my ken, but this makes all the difference and I’m off now to purchase PureRaw 6 and add it to my Lightroom Classic workflow.
This is indeed a most significant upgrade and with PR6 DxO remains the benchmark for pre-development of raw files on the market today

Hello Jim,

We’re quite surprised by your feedback, especially regarding file size, as one of the key new features in DxO PureRAW 6 is precisely the introduction of DNG High-Fidelity compression. This format can produce files up to four times smaller than the original while preserving optimal image quality, allowing detailed zoom without any visible loss — ideal for lighter and more efficient workflows.

It sounds like this option may not have been selected during your processing. Could you please check if you used this output format?

Hello Gennaro,

we understand your frustration regarding the lack of support for the Leica Q2 and Q3 Monochrome in DxO PhotoLab and DxO PureRAW. We’re glad to hear you enjoy the software overall.

Supporting monochrome sensors is actually more complex than it may seem, as their image processing differs significantly from standard Bayer sensors, which requires specific development and calibration work from our teams.

A great app that can transform RAW images

A great app that can transform your RAW images.
The built-in noise reduction and lens modules are the best you can get.
If you come from Lightroom there is quite a steep learning curve but with a bit of effort you can get just as good if not better results than you can in Lightroom.
There is no need to import the photos into a catalogue you just open your images from a file browser so there is no large catalogues to back-up and take up space on your hard drives.
Non subscription is nice too.
All in all a great RAW photo editing app.
